Mahajanga/ Majunga vs Coco Island Climate & Distance Between

Myanmar flag
  • The distance between Mahajanga/ Majunga, Madagascar and Coco Island, Myanmar is approximately 6,138 km or 3,814 mi.
  • To reach Mahajanga/ Majunga in this distance one would set out from Coco Island bearing 239.1°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Mahajanga/ Majunga bearing 239.8° or WSW .
  • Mahajanga/ Majunga has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Coco Island has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
  • The mean annual temperature is 0.8 °C (1.4°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.5 °C (0.9°F) more in Mahajanga/ Majunga.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ic for both.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1350 mm (53.1 in) less which is equivalent to 1350 l/m² (33.13 US gal/ft²) or 13,500,000 l/ha (1,443,240 US gal/ac) less. About 1/2 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 1.6° lower in Mahajanga/ Majunga than in Coco Island.
